Venomous Snake Bites Venomous Snake: Shocking Truth Revealed!
- •Venomous snakes possess natural resistance, not full immunity, to the venom of their own species, a result of millions of years of evolution.
- •A cobra biting another cobra results in venom injection, but the bitten cobra's body has antibodies and protein structures to neutralize its own species' venom, leading to minor effects like swelling.
- •The danger significantly increases when a snake bites another snake of a different species, as venom types vary greatly.
- •King Snakes are an exception, known for eating other venomous snakes due to their strong resistance to diverse venoms.
- •Death in snake fights is often due to wound infection (Sepsis) or extreme stress, rather than the venom itself, which snakes primarily use for hunting or self-preservation.
Why It Matters: Venomous snakes have natural resistance to their own species' venom, but inter-species bites are dangerous.
